Overnight Shooting in Richmond

Shots were heard around 3 a.m.

Richmond police are investigating an overnight shooting that sent one man to the hospital who was in a Porsche Cayenne at S. 7th and Virginia streets.

Investigators say their "shot spotter" technology signaled that multiple shots were being fired in the area at 3 a.m.

They arrived and found the victim slumped over the steering wheel. He was airlifted to John Muir Medical Center.

His condition is unknown. A second car - a white four door sedan - was also at the scene.

An officer tells NBC Bay Area that two people in that car may have been related to the victim and were talking with police. Investigators are still trying to figure out if the shooter was on foot or in a car.
